AAB Statement: Ben Niall

Statement from the Agent Accreditation Board in relation to player agent Ben Niall.

The Agent Accreditation Board (AAB) has found player agent Ben Niall to be in breach of Clause 13.10 of the Agents’ Code of Conduct, which prohibits an agent from doing, or failing to do, anything which results in a Player being in breach of the Regulations or the AFL Rules & Regulations.

It was found that Mr Niall failed to lodge an independent agreement in respect of a commercial arrangement for a client, as required under AFL rules. The player was not sanctioned for the breach by the AFL.

In determining the appropriate penalty, the AAB noted that Mr Niall has no prior disciplinary action under the regulations, at all times has taken responsibility for the breach and has co-operated with both the original AFL investigation and subsequent AFLPA investigation.

After considering all of the circumstances, the AAB has sanctioned Mr Niall with a fine of $2,500 (half of which is suspended) and further education regarding the relevant AFL rules.
